Expressive Art and Design – Music

As the weather is going to be sunny today I would like you to go outside and find some natural materials or items in and around your house to use for making music.

For example you could find some sticks to tap together or scrape across each other

Or some saucepans or tins to bang

Or make a shaker using a plastic bottle or tub with stones, rice or pasta inside

When you have made your musical instruments try them out one by one. Do they sound the same? Or different? Choose some songs to sing while you play your instruments.

For today’s activity you will need:

  • A toy chicken or bird
  • Something that you can use as worms (cooked spaghetti, wool, string etc)
  • A dice (or two if you would like a challenge)

Now I would like you to roll the dice and feed the hen that number of worms. If you find that really easy then I would like you to roll the dice and your grown up can ask you what is 1 more or 1 less than that number; now you need to feed the hen that number of worms. If that is still too easy for you I would like you to roll 2 dice and add the numbers together. Can you feed the hen that number of worms?
